Absence of Credentials and Experience
When it pertains to picking a LASIK specialist, qualifications and experience are your very first line of protection against potential issues. You desire a doctor that's board-certified and has a strong performance history in performing LASIK procedures.
Seek someone with specialized training in refractive surgery and a significant number of successful surgical procedures under their belt. Do not wait to inquire about their experience with the certain modern technology being used for your procedure.
Checking on-line reviews and endorsements can also offer valuable insights right into their track record. If a surgeon seems unclear concerning their certifications or has little experience, consider it a warning.
Depend on your impulses; a knowledgeable, skilled specialist can make a substantial difference in your LASIK journey.
Limited Innovation and Surgical Options
Picking a LASIK specialist that restricts themselves to outdated innovation or a slim range of surgical options can endanger your vision results.
Modern LASIK treatments use sophisticated lasers and methods that enhance accuracy and safety. If your cosmetic surgeon insists on older techniques, it might show they're not staying on top of sector improvements. This lack of advancement may suggest you won't receive the best feasible treatment or results.
In addition, your doctor must offer a variety of options customized to your certain vision needs, such as custom-made LASIK or various other refractive treatments. A restricted approach may not resolve your special situations, so it's crucial to ask about the innovation and alternatives readily available before making your choice.
Your vision is entitled to the most effective therapy possible.

Inadequate Preoperative Assessments
A detailed preoperative analysis is essential for ensuring you're a suitable candidate for LASIK surgical procedure, as poor analyses can lead to complications and poor end results.
During this assessment, your surgeon needs to examine your eye wellness, vision prescription, corneal density, and general case history.
If you see your doctor hurrying via this process or avoiding necessary tests, it's a substantial red flag. You deserve a thorough evaluation customized to your unique demands.
Any kind of doctor that does not put in the time to understand your particular scenario might not prioritize your safety or lasting vision health and wellness.
Do not think twice to ask questions regarding the assessment procedure and make sure whatever is covered prior to making any choices about your surgery. Your eyes are worthy of the best treatment possible.
